Alexander Andreevich Samarskii
Alexander Andreevich Samarskii (Александр Андреевич Самарский, 19 February 1919, Amvrosiivka, metropolitan Donetsk, Yekaterinoslav Governorate – 11 February 2008, Moscow) was a Soviet and Russian mathematician and academician (USSR Academy of Sciences, Russian Academy of Sciences), specializing in mathematical physics, applied mathematics, numerical analysis, mathematical modeling, finite difference methods. Education and career Born in Amvrosiivka, Yekaterinoslav Governorate, Russian Empire (now, Donetsk Oblast, Ukraine). Samarskii studied from 1936 at Moscow State University, interrupted from 1941 to 1944 by voluntary military service in WW II — he was severely wounded in the Battle of Moscow. In 1948 he received his Russian candidate degree (Ph.D.). At the same time, he worked with Andrey Nikolayevich Tikhonov on mathematical modeling of nuclear weapon explosions and electromagnetic fields in waveguides. Mikhail Samarsky
Mikhail Aleksandrovich Samarsky (russian: link=no, Михаил Александрович Самарский, born 15 August 1996, Rostov-on-Don) is a Russian writer, blogger and public figure. He is an honorary member of the Union of Russian-speaking writers of Bulgaria and president of the charitable foundation "Living Hearts" («Живые сердца») Biography Samarsky was born on 15 August 1996 in Rostov-on-Don and has lived in Moscow since 1997. He studied at Moscow's School No. 1084 from 2003 to 2007 and at School No. 1239 from 2007 to 2012. From 2012 to 2013, he studied at the School of External Studies No. 1, which is affiliated with Moscow State University. In 2013, he was admitted to the Department of Political Science of Moscow State University. Vassili Samarsky-Bykhovets
Vasili Yevgrafovich Samarsky-Bykhovets (russian: Василий Евграфович Самарский-Быховец; 7 November 1803 – 31 May 1870) was a Russian mining engineer and the chief of Russian Mining Engineering Corps between 1845 and 1861. Samara Oblast
Samara Oblast ( rus, Сама́рская о́бласть, r=Samarskaya oblast, p=sɐˈmarskəjə ˈobləsʲtʲ) is a federal subjects of Russia, federal subject of Russia (an oblast). Its administrative center is the types of inhabited localities in Russia, city of Samara. From 1935 to 1991, it was known as Kuybyshev Oblast ( rus, Ку́йбышевская о́бласть, r=Kuybyshevskaya Oblast, p=ˈkujbɨʂɨfskəjə ˈobləsʲtʲ). As of the Russian Census (2010), 2010 Census, the population of the oblast was 3,215,532. The oblast borders Tatarstan in the north, Orenburg Oblast in the east, Kazakhstan (West Kazakhstan Province) in the south, Saratov Oblast in the southwest and Ulyanovsk Oblast in the west. History The Samara region contains a remarkable succession of archaeological cultures from 7000 BC to 4000 BC.
